Output 255d3f2ae0deb323927e28396e9c4af1bb47d01f8c507fd72711129b201aefb5:0

value
6943716120253
script pubkey
OP_0 OP_PUSHBYTES_20 3317239c090276f8f7bc4f414193ff18da489f2a
address
tb1qxvtj88qfqfm03aaufaq5ryllrrdy38e2eg3zqv
transaction
255d3f2ae0deb323927e28396e9c4af1bb47d01f8c507fd72711129b201aefb5
confirmations
192678
spent
true